Unplug and Disassemble
- Ensure the mixer is unplugged from the power outlet for safety.
- Remove all attachments, such as the stainless steel flat beater, by releasing the attachment lever.
- Detach any other removable parts like the bowl or splash guard if applicable.

Clean the Attachments
- Wash the stainless steel flat beater with warm, soapy water. Since it’s dishwasher safe, you can also clean it in the dishwasher for convenience.
- Use a soft sponge or brush to remove any stuck-on residue.
- Rinse thoroughly and dry completely before reattaching.
Wipe the Mixer Base
Use a damp, soft cloth to wipe down the exterior of the mixer base. Avoid soaking or spraying water directly onto the motor housing to prevent internal damage. For stubborn spots, use a mild dish soap solution and then wipe with a clean damp cloth.
Dry and Reassemble
Ensure all cleaned parts are fully dry before reassembling. Attach the beater and any other accessories securely. Plug in the mixer and perform a brief test run to confirm everything works properly.
Tips and Warnings
- Do not immerse the mixer motor housing in water or any liquid.
- Regularly inspect the beater for signs of wear or damage and replace if necessary.
-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ive scrubbers on the stainless steel parts.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I put the stainless steel beater in the dishwasher?
Yes, the stainless steel flat beater is dishwasher safe, making it easy to clean thoroughly after heavy use.
How often should I clean my mixer and attachments?
It’s best to clean the attachments after each use and do a general wipe-down of the mixer weekly to prevent residue buildup.
Is it safe to get water inside the motor housing?
No, avoid getting water in the motor housing. Use a damp cloth for cleaning the exterior only.
